Small kitchen appliance manufacturers and wholesalers provide a range of commercial-grade small kitchen appliances, including blenders, espresso makers, food processors, iced tea makers, and can openers. Major suppliers include large retailers and appliance manufacturers. Key buyers of small kitchen appliances are homeowners, renters, cooks, and individuals or families looking to streamline meal preparation and improve kitchen efficiency.

The average profit margin across vendors in the Small Kitchen Appliances market is 7% and steady. Profit levels shift depending on suppliers' spend on wages, purchases and overhead. The highest cost component for vendors is Wages. The cost trend for this component is falling, when considering movement between 2024 and 2025. Average vendor risk in the market is low, indicating that suppliers face little risk of bankruptcy or insolvency.
Supply chain risk is moderate, as the market heavily depends on volatile inputs such as plastic and steel.
Market share concentration is high, which reduces the overall number of suppliers that buyers can source products from. However, there still exists a heavy amount of competition within the market due to the nearly homogenous nature of the products.
The United States is a net importer of electrical appliances, meaning buyers benefit from easy access to global vendors that may be able to offer lower prices.

Managing vendor performance throughout the contract period is easier when tracking specific key performance indicators (KPIs). For example, buyers should monitor Average Order Value and Mean Time to Failure (MTTF). Buyers may experience better performance throughout their contracts if they establish service level agreements (SLAs) based on Specifications and other factors.

Organizational Overview
Buyers should describe their organizations and explain why they are seeking small kitchen appliances.
Buyers need to give a description of what their current solutions are, especially which kitchen appliances and features they utilize the most. This overview should give vendors enough information to determine whether they can meet the buyer's needs.
Statement Of Need
Buyers should provide the intended use of the kitchen appliances and the number of units desired.
Buyers should state specifications, such as appliance size and power, that are desired for each kitchen appliance.
Project Budget
Buyers should explicitly state the amount of the contract award.
Buyers should explain when and how many payments will be made.
